+/**
|
|
|
+ * <p>
|
|
|
+ * Given a <code>Collection</code> of domain object instances returned from a
|
|
|
+ * secure object invocation, remove any <code>Collection</code> elements the
|
|
|
+ * principal does not have appropriate permission to access as defined by the
|
|
|
+ * {@link AclManager}.
|
|
|
+ * </p>
|
|
|
+ *
|
|
|
+ * <p>
|
|
|
+ * The <code>AclManager</code> is used to retrieve the access control list
|
|
|
+ * (ACL) permissions associated with each <code>Collection</code> domain
|
|
|
+ * object instance element for the current <code>Authentication</code> object.
|
|
|
+ * This class is designed to process {@link AclEntry}s that are subclasses of
|
|
|
+ * {@link net.sf.acegisecurity.acl.basic.AbstractBasicAclEntry} only.
|
|
|
+ * Generally these are obtained by using the {@link
|
|
|
+ * net.sf.acegisecurity.acl.basic.BasicAclProvider}.
|
|
|
+ * </p>
|
|
|
+ *
|
|
|
+ * <p>
|
|
|
+ * This after invocation provider will fire if any {@link
|
|
|
+ * ConfigAttribute#getAttribute()} matches the {@link
|
|
|
+ * #processConfigAttribute}. The provider will then lookup the ACLs from the
|
|
|
+ * <code>AclManager</code> and ensure the principal is {@link
|
|
|
+ * net.sf.acegisecurity.acl.basic.AbstractBasicAclEntry#isPermitted(int)} for
|
|
|
+ * at least one of the {@link #requirePermission}s for each
|
|
|
+ * <code>Collection</code> element. If the principal does not have at least
|
|
|
+ * one of the permissions, that element will not be included in the returned
|
|
|
+ * <code>Collection</code>.
|
|
|
+ * </p>
|
|
|
+ *
|
|
|
+ * <p>
|
|
|
+ * Often users will setup a <code>BasicAclEntryAfterInvocationProvider</code>
|
|
|
+ * with a {@link #processConfigAttribute} of
|
|
|
+ * <code>AFTER_ACL_COLLECTION_READ</code> and a {@link #requirePermission} of
|
|
|
+ * <code>SimpleAclEntry.READ</code>. These are also the defaults.
|
|
|
+ * </p>
|
|
|
+ *
|
|
|
+ * <p>
|
|
|
+ * The <code>AclManager</code> is allowed to return any implementations of
|
|
|
+ * <code>AclEntry</code> it wishes. However, this provider will only be able
|
|
|
+ * to validate against <code>AbstractBasicAclEntry</code>s, and thus a
|
|
|
+ * <code>Collection</code> element will be filtered from the resulting
|
|
|
+ * <code>Collection</code> if no <code>AclEntry</code> is of type
|
|
|
+ * <code>AbstractBasicAclEntry</code>.
|
|
|
+ * </p>
|
|
|
+ *
|
|
|
+ * <p>
|
|
|
+ * If the provided <code>returnObject</code> is <code>null</code>, a
|
|
|
+ * <code>null</code><code>Collection</code> will be returned. If the provided
|
|
|
+ * <code>returnObject</code> is not a <code>Collection</code>, an {@link
|
|
|
+ * AuthorizationServiceException} will be thrown.
|
|
|
+ * </p>
|
|
|
+ *
|
|
|
+ * <p>
|
|
|
+ * All comparisons and prefixes are case sensitive.
|
|
|
+ * </p>
|
|
|
+ *
|
|
|
+ * @author Ben Alex
|
|
|
+ * @version $Id$
|
|
|
+ */
